Powerful Modern Techniques
For many years naval architects and designers have considered the flows of water around the hulls of vessels. The flow of air around the superstructure was only considered for particularly demanding applications, usually in the military world. However, the owners of luxury private vessels can now take advantage of these design techniques to ensure a comfortable environment free from exhaust plumes, and a safe platform for helicopter landings.
Safe Helicopter Operation
Helicopters landing on ships can be affected by both the wake created by the superstructure, and the ingestion of the exhaust plume into the aircraft’s engines.
